/* header on ( moved to star-media.css)*/
/* header off */

/* bredcramp on */
.bredcramp ul {margin:0; padding:10px 12px 0 12px; list-style:none; font-weight:bold; font-size:11px}
.bredcramp ul li {float:left}
.bredcramp ul li a {padding:0 3px; color:#fff; background-color:inherit}
.bredcramp ul li a:hover {text-decoration:none}
.bredcramp span {color:#aaa; background-color:inherit; padding:0 3px}
/* bredcramp off */

/* content on */
.layL h2 {font-size:14px; margin:0; padding:0 0 10px 15px}
.contentList {padding:30px 50px}
.contentList h2 {padding:0}
.contentList a {color:#ffffff; background-color:inherit; text-decoration:underline}
.contentList a:hover {text-decoration:none}

.imageList {width:690px; margin-top:6px; margin-left:6px; ma\rgin-left /**/:12px; float:left; color:inherit; background-color:#222223}
.imageViewer #horizontal {float:left}
.imageViewerList {float:right; padding-top:27px; width:240px}
.imageViewerList ol {background:url('../images/GaleryOlBg.jpg') repeat-y top left; border-left:1px #000000 solid; border-right:1px #000000 solid; height:422px; margin:0 10px 0 0; padding:0 0 0 30px}
.imageViewerList li {color:#FF2626; background-color:inherit; font-size:12px; margin:0; padding:4px 0 2px 20px}
.imageViewerList li a {text-decoration:none; color:#fff; background-color:inherit}
.imageViewerList li a span {color:#8A8989; background-color:inherit; padding-left:5px}
.rContent .imageViewerList {width:100%; float:none; padding:0}
.rContent .imageViewerList ol {height:auto; border:0; margin:0}
.lContent .imageViewer div.horizontal {width:412px}
.lContent .imageViewer div.horizontal .hold {width:298px}

.itemContent {float:left; cursor:pointer; margin:-13px 0; width:222px}
.itemContent h3 {width:220px; height:36px; cursor:pointer; font-size:10px; margin:0; padding:0; background:#2E2E2E url('../images/itemContentBG.jpg') no-repeat bottom left; border:1px #2C2C2C solid; border-bottom:none}
.itemContent h3 p {margin:0; padding:15px 0 0 10px; float:left; color:#FE3838; background:transporant}
.itemContent h3 img {float:right; width:50px; height:35px}
.itemContent .topBorder {position:relative; bottom:-6px; b\ottom /**/:-7px}
.itemContent .bottomBorder {position:relative; top:-11px; t\op /**/:-12px}
.itemContentContainer {width:220px; height:125px; color:inherit; background:#0a0a0a url('../images/itemContentContainerBG.jpg') no-repeat top left; border-left:1px #2C2C2C solid; border-right:1px #2c2c2c solid;}
.itemContentContainer .content {padding:10px 15px; font-size:11px}
.itemContentContainer .contentTitle {background-color:#171717; color:#747474; font-weight:bold; margin:0; padding:3px 15px; border-bottom:1px #323232 solid}

#rightBarItms {clear:both; border-bottom:1px #242424 solid; margin-left:1px;}
#rightBarItms .imgContainer {float:left; padding-right:15px}
#rightBarItms .imgContainer img {float:left; width:50px; height:35px}
#news {padding:3px 0 3px 5px; border-top:1px #242424 solid}
#rightBarItms .passive .cont, #rightBarItms .cont {display:none}
#rightBarItms .active .cont {display:block}
#rightBarItms .cont {padding-right:5px}
.over .newsTitle {color:#8a8a8a}
.newsTitle {padding:5px 5px 5px 0; cursor:pointer; display:table; height:1%; height/**/ /**/:/**/auto; min-height:1px}
#rightBarItms .detLink {padding:5px 0; margin:0; text-align:right}
#rightBarItms .detLink a:hover {text-decoration:underline}

.theme {padding:15px 0 0 12px; float:left}
.themePoll {padding:0 0 10px 5px}
.themePoll, .layR .theme {border-bottom:1px #2A2A2A solid; margin:0 0 1px 1px}
.layR .theme {border-top:7px #2A2A2A solid; float:none; padding:13px 0 5px 10px; display:table; height:1%; height/**/ /**/:/**/auto; min-height:1px}
.layR .theme .imgContainer {float:left; padding-right:10px}
.layR .itemContent, .layR .itemContent h3, .layR  .itemContentContainer {width:220px}
.layR h3, .layR .project .itemContent .itemContentContainer {background:none}
.layR .project {padding-left:9px}
.layR .project .bottomBorder {to\p /**/:-10px}
.project {clear:both; height:1%; height/**/ /**/:/**/auto; min-height:1px}
.project .itemContent h3 {height:50px; border-bottom:1px #2C2C2C solid}
.project .itemContent h3 img {width:220px; height:50px}
.project .itemContent .itemContentContainer {background:#0d0d0d url('../images/sMedia.jpg') no-repeat top left; height:120px; color:inherit}

.themeTeam, .themeTeamHover {padding:12px 0 10px 12px; position:relative; paddi\ng-top /**/:11px; margin-left:9px; background:url('../images/listImgBg.gif') no-repeat top left; float:left}
.themeTeamHover h3 a {color:#FF3D3D !important; background-color:inherit}
.themeTeamHover h3 a, .themeTeam h3 a {padding:2px 0 2px 10px}
.teamList h3 {width:auto; background-image:none}
.teamList .itemContentContainer {width:auto; height:100px; hei\ght /**/:140px; background-image:none}
.teamList .itemContentContainer .content {clear:both}
.teamList .itemContent h3 {background-image:none; float:right; width:119px; height:auto; background-color:#1C1C1C; color:inherit; border-left:none; border-right:none; border-bottom:1px #343434 solid}
.teamList .itemContent h3 a {display:block; color:#7E7E7E; background-color:inherit; text-decoration:none}
.teamList .itemContent {width:212px}
.teamList .imgContainer {float:left; margin-bottom:-4px}
.teamList .imgContainer div {border-right:2px #333333 solid; display:table; float:left; flo\at /**/:none}
.teamList .imgContainer img {width:90px; height:46px; float:left}
.teamList .imgContainer img.imgBorder {width:92px; height:4px; clear:both; position:relative; top:-1px; to\p/**/:-3px}
.teamList .imgHeader {height:1%; height/**/ /**/:/**/auto; min-height:1px; background-color:#0A0A0A; border-right:1px #343434 solid}
/* content off */

.extraLnks a img {margin-right:3px}
.extraLnks a:hover {text-decoration:underline}
.adminButton {position:absolute; margin:-20px 0 0 0; right:0}

/* right bar on */
.banerList {border-bottom:1px #242424 solid; width:203px; float:right; background:transparent}
.themeBaner {padding:3px 0; clear:both; width:203px; float:right; border-top:1px #242424 solid; background:transparent}
.themeBaner .banerImg {float:left; padding:0 5px}
/* right bar off */

/* search on */
.layR .searchform {margin:0 0 8px 0; padding:1px 0 0 0; height:38px; float:left; width:100%; background:url('../images/searchText.jpg') no-repeat bottom right}
.searchform input {border:2px #292929 solid; height:18px; margin:0; padding:0 4px; float:right; color:#000000; width:212px; w\idth:204px; background:#ffffff url('../images/searchWhiteBG.jpg') repeat-x top left}
.layR input.searchButton {border:none; width:23px; height:22px; float:left; background:url('../images/go.jpg') no-repeat top left}
.layR .searchform p {margin:0; padding:1px 15px 0 0; float:right}
/* search off */

/* searchResult on */
.searchResultAll {padding:10px 12px 0 12px}
.searchResultAll .searchResultHeader {width:100%; padding:5px 0; margin-bottom:20px; float:left; background-color:#222223}
.searchResultAll .searchResultHeader p {margin:0; padding:0; color:#828282}
.searchResultAll .searchResultHeader span, .searchResultAll .result span {padding:0 5px; color:#ffffff}
.searchResultAll span.spanLine {font-weight:bold; position:relative; top:-2px; color:#828282; font-size:7px}
.searchResultAll p.result {width:275px; float:left; padding-left:10px}
.searchResultAll .find {float:right}
.searchResultAll .searchResult {clear:both; padding-top:10px; paddi\ng-top /**/:30px}
.searchResultAll .searchform {margin:0; padding:0}
.searchResultAll .searchform div {background-color:#292929; padding:2px 2px 2px 0; paddi\ng-left /**/:2px; margin-left:3px; float:left}
.searchResultAll .searchform input {width:220px; height:22px; height /**/:20px; float:left}
.searchResultAll .searchform input.btnSubmit {width:auto; height:auto; float:none; padding:0px 8px 0px 8px; margin:0; border:1px #8D8D8D solid; border-right-color:#323232; border-bottom-color:#4F4F4F; background-color:#4F4F4F; background-image:none; color:#ffffff}
.searchResult {margin:0; padding:0 36px}
.searchResult dt {border-bottom:2px #2A2A2A solid; margin:0 0 10px 0; padding:0 5px 2px 5px}
.searchResult dt a {color:#FF2121; font-weight:bold}
.searchResult dd {margin:0; padding:0 5px}
.searchResult dd span {color:red}
.searchScroller {border-bottom:1px #2A2A2A solid; clear:both; width:619px; display:table; height:1%; height/**/ /**/:/**/auto; min-height:1px; padding:20px 0 3px 0; margin-left:36px}
.searchScroller .result {float:left; padding:0 5px; color:#828282}
.searchScroller .scroller {float:right}
.resultNone {text-align:center}
/* searchResult off */

.bredcramp {height:30px}

/* sitemap on */
.sitemap {padding:10px 0 0 20px}
.sitemap .parentCntt {background:url('../images/sitemapBg.jpg') no-repeat top left; height:420px; he\ight /**/:auto; min-height:420px; width:670px; padding-top:20px; float:left}
.sitemap .parentCntt .brd {width:647px; float:right}
.sitemap .parentCntt .brd b {border-color:#2F2F2F}
.sitemap .parentCntt .brd .b1 {background-color:#2F2F2F}
.sitemap .brd .b2, .sitemap .brd .b3, .sitemap .brd .b4, .sitemap .brd .b5, .sitemap .brd .b6 {background-color:#080808}
.sitemap .parentCntt .cntr {border-left:1px #2F2F2F solid; border-right:1px #2F2F2F solid; height:350px; he\ight /**/:auto; min-height:350px; background-color:#080808; width:645px; padding-bottom:60px; float:right}
.sitemap .col1 {float:left; width:49%}
.sitemap .col2 {float:right; width:49%}
.sitemap .products dl {width:240px; float:left}
.sitemap .products dl a {display:block; float:left}
.sitemap dl {margin:15px 0 15px 45px; padding:0 0 0 12px; background:url('../images/redPoint.gif') no-repeat 0 5px;}
.sitemap dl a:hover {text-decoration:underline}
.sitemap dt {margin:0; padding:0; font-family:"Trebuchet MS",sans-serif; font-size:12px; font-weight:bold;}
.sitemap dt a {background:url('../image/arrow.gif') no-repeat right 3px; padding-right:15px}
.sitemap dd {padding-top:2px}
.sitemap dd a {color:#848484}
/* sitemap off */

/* poll on */
.question {color:#7F7F7F; font-size:12px; background-color:inherit; margin:0; padding:5px 0}
.answer {padding:5px 0 1px 10px}
#pollVotingSystem .button {margin-top:5px;}
.poll {clear:both; padding-left:5px}
.poll form {margin:0; padding:0}
.poll label {display:block; c2ursor:pointer;}
.poll label input {margin-left:0; padding-left:0; border:0}
.poll a {color:#ffffff; background-color:inherit; text-decoration:none}
.poll a:hover {text-decoration:underline}
#pollVotingSystem {padding-bottom:10px}
.sePollSmallRes {padding-right:10px;}
  .sePollSmallRes span {float:right; width:20px; text-align:right;}
  .pollLine {height:4px; margin:1px 0 3px 10px; background:url('../images/pollBG.jpg') repeat-x top left}
.poll .submit {margin-top:5px}
.poll .pollLine {margin-left:0}
.poll .klein {font-weight:bold}

.pollArhivList .scroller {padding-left:15px}
.pollArhiv {padding:15px 0 0 20px}
.pollArhiv .pollContent {width:670px; padding-top:10px}
.pollArhiv h2 {width:670px; float/**/ /**/:/**/left; margin:0; padding:0; font-size:12px; color:inherit; background-color:#131313}
.pollArhiv img {float:left; float/**/ /**/:/**/none}
.pollArhiv span {float:left; padding:2px 0 2px 10px}
.pollArhiv span.date {background-color:inherit; color:#757575; font-size:10px; float:right; width:300px; text-align:left; padding-left:0}

ul.scroller {list-style:none; cursor:default; padding:2px 0 5px 15px; margin:0}
ul.scroller li {display:inline}
ul.scroller li.arrow {padding:0 0px; background-color:inherit; color:#fff}
ul.scroller li a {border:2px solid #FF5A5A; border-right-color:#6d0000; border-bottom-color:#6D0000; color:inherit; background:#870200 url(../images/galery-h-ctrl-btn-bg.gif) 0 0 repeat-x; text-decoration:none; font:normal bold 10px/12px Tahoma, sans-serif; padding:0 3px; cursor:pointer}
ul.scroller li a:hover {color:#262626}
ul.scroller li.active a {background:#404040 url(../images/scrollerBg.gif) 0 0 repeat-x; border:2px solid #8a8a8a; border-right-color:#262626; border-bottom-color:#262626; color:#ffffff}
ul.scroller li.active a:hover {color:#ffffff; cursor:default}
ul.scroller li a:active, .scroller li a:focus {outline-style:none}

ul.scroller li span {padding:0 3px;background:#404040 url(../images/scrollerBg.gif) 0 0 repeat-x; border:2px solid #8a8a8a; border-right-color:#262626; border-bottom-color:#262626; color:#fff; font:normal bold 10px/12px Tahoma, sans-serif;}
/* poll off */

/* footer on */
.footer p {margin:0; padding:0 5px 0 0}
.footer p a {text-decoration:none; background-color:inherit; color:#fff}
/* footer off */

.layR .seProductLst .itm .cntt {background:none}
.layR .seProductLst .itm .cntt h4 {display:none}

.movieCinema {width:100%; float:left}
.admGaleryLst .itm .right div {clear:both}
.movie strong {float:left}
.movie img {float:right}
.topCinema {float:right; margin:0; padding:0 10px}
.topCinema img {margin-right:10px; float:left}
.itmTheme {position:relative}
.itmTheme .cinema {position:absolute; right:10px; bottom:5px}

.seProductLst .itm .cntt h4 {display:table; position:relative; overflow:hidden; width:220px; height:35px; padding:0}
.seProductLst .itm .cntt h4 div {display:table-cell; position:absolute; top:50%; pos\ition /**/:static; width:220px; text-align:center; vertical-align:middle}
.seProductLst .itm .cntt h4 span {display:block; position:relative; top:-50%; pos\ition /**/:static}

.leaderboard a {float:left}
.swither {padding:75px 0 0 77px; padding-left /**/:82px; display:table; height:1%; height /**/:auto; min-height:1px}
.swither a {background-color:#000000; color:red; margin:0 0 0 5px; padding:0; _height:17px; width:40px; border:1px #cccccc solid; font-weight:bold;text-align:center;}
[className="swither"] {padding-left:60px}
